SPECIFICATIONS

Power consumption: ............................................................230 V ~ 50 Hz, 1080W
Output: ............................................................................................................700W
Operating Frequency: ..............................................................................2450 MHz
Outside Dimensions: ............................... 454 mm (L) x 330 mm (W) x 262 mm (H)
Oven Cavity Dimensions:........................ 315 mm (L) x 296 mm (W) x 211 mm (H)
Oven Capacity: ............................................................................................20 litres
Cooking Uniformity:....................................................Turntable system (ø245 mm)
Uncrated Weight: ............................................................................Approx. 10.5 kg

BEFORE YOU CALL FOR SERVICE

1. If the oven will not perform at all, the display does not appear or the display

disappeared:
a) Check to ensure that the oven is plugged in securely. If it is not, remove the

plug from the outlet, wait 10 seconds and plug it in again securely.

b) Check the premises for a blown circuit fuse or a tripped main circuit

breaker. If these seem to be operating properly, test the outlet with another
appliance.

2. If the microwave power will not function:

a) Check to see whether the timer is set.
b) Check to make sure that the door is securely closed to engage the safety

interlocks. Otherwise, the microwave energy will not flow into the oven.

IF NONE OF THE ABOVE RECTIFY THE SITUATION, THEN CONTACT THE

NEAREST AUTHORIZED SERVICE AGENT.
